Mid-Century Modern Refined in Dunthorpe
The goal for this classic mid-century modern gem was clear: provide a complete kitchen upgrade that felt as though it had always been part of the original floor plan. To honor the home’s iconic roots, we selected a palette that feels both fresh and nostalgic.
The design centers on clean, white matte lacquer cabinetry paired with a warm wood-laminate island. To create a seamless transition between the kitchen and dining area, we utilized dividing base units that define the rooms without closing them off. Rather than fighting the home’s unique architecture, we embraced its interesting angles by creating a custom, floor-to-ceiling wall of shallow storage—even incorporating a clever hidden compartment for the Lutron lighting controls. A matching floating credenza in the dining room serves as the final thread, tying the two spaces together in perfect mid-century harmony.
